Governor Abbott Commemorates Hurricane Harvey Anniversary In Fulton, TX

Governor Greg Abbott today commemorated the 2nd anniversary of Hurricane Harvey by delivering remarks at the groundbreaking of the new Fulton Pier and ceremonially signing into law Senate Bill 6 (Kolkhorst/Morrison) and House Bill 6 (Morrison/Hunter/Kolkhorst) in Fulton, TX. The Governor was joined by Senator Lois Kolkhorst, Representative Geanie Morrison, Representative Todd Hunter, Mayor of Fulton Jimmy Kendrick, Mayor of Rockport Pat Rios, and other state and local leaders for the ceremony.

Burns Original BBQ is Hosting Annual Scholarship Luncheon Event To Provide 10 Local Recent High School Grads With Financial Assistance For Fall 2022!

It all started in 1973 when Roy Burns Sr. started off his small local business venture selling barbecue to the Acres Home community in Houston, Tx. Today, Burn's Original BBQ (and sister restaurant Burns Burger Shack) are Texas staples that people come from all over the world to taste. Due to the overwhelming love of Burns Original BBQ, people have demanded that the BBQ hotspot cater their events, big and small, and they have for years. The Burns family is committed to helping their community as they provide scholarships, free food, and host community events yearly.

Woman Jailed at 14 for Allegedly Shoving White Teacher’s Aide Releases Memoir Detailing Life in the Aftermath

ShaQuanda Cotton, who in 2006 was sentenced to up to 7 years confinement at a Texas juvenile detention facility as a black teen following accusations that she pushed a white teacher’s aide, announces

On September 30, 2005, 14-year-old ShaQuanda Cotton attempted to enter a school building to take a prescribed medication before classes began. An encounter with a teacher’s aide on her way to the nurse’s office that morning led to her arrest, and months later the teen was adjudicated delinquent by a Lamar County court for assault on a public servant. What began as an ordinary day at school resulted in her being removed from the care of her mother and sentenced to an indeterminate term of up to seven years in a Texas juvenile detention facility. Cotton, now 30, recently published a personal account of the ordeal after years of being subjected to rumors and vitriol in the small town of Paris, Texas.

Media Visionary Dave Mays Launches Hip-Hop Podcast Network

Breakbeat to Produce Diverse Array of Compelling Podcast Content Serving the Global Hip-Hop Community

Media visionary Dave Mays, creator of The Source magazine, and business and finance heavyweight Kendrick Ashton have partnered to launch Breakbeat, a multi-media podcast network built to serve the interests and perspectives of the global Hip-Hop community. Breakbeat will deliver authentic, premium, and relevant audio and video content capturing the Hip-Hop community's distinct point-of-view. The platform, which will begin releasing its first shows on Tuesday, September 28th, will produce scripted, non-fiction narrative, news and discussion content, covering a wide range of subjects.
